Janet Fleming (1952-2024) was a woman we will all remember for bringing humor and laughter to any room she entered. Her smile and spirit were contagious, and she loved her family and friends beyond measure. Jannie was born to Norman and Colleen Andersen in Audubon, Iowa. She grew up with three siblings: Vicky, Karen, and Richard. Jannie eventually made her home in Omaha, NE, where she raised two daughters, Natalie and Amanda. She had six grandchildren who all held a special bond with their Gaga. She held several jobs outside of being a mom, including working in photography, cleaning houses, and, lastly, being the voice and go-to gal in the computer industry for Futureware and Geeks. Through her laughter and genuine heart, Jannie made lasting friendships and was an instant friend to anyone who met her. Jannie was a passionate crafter of any sort and an A+ Goodwill shopper. The kids and grandkids were sure to receive items that were “brand new, with the tags.” Jannie eventually married Bruce, whom she considered her prince and she was his princess. They enjoyed collecting things together, and Mom helped with monitoring corn prices over the years, secretly enjoying this task. She married into a family she truly loved. In late 2021, Jannie was diagnosed with leiomyosarcoma. She never said no and fought until there was no more fight left in her. She continued to show up for everyone and smiled through her pain and fears. Jannie’s memory will remain in the hearts of her family, friends, and all those who had the privilege of knowing her. She is survived by her husband Bruce; daughters Natalie (Terry) Sanderson and Amanda (Tracy) Bryan; mother-in-law Jeri Fleming; sisters Vicky Stetzel, Karen (Denny) Hegland; brother Richard (Karen) Andersen; sisters-in-law Connie (Mike) Emanuel and Barbara Gay; brother-in-law Bradley Fleming; grandchildren Tyler, Macie, Madisyn, Bo, and Luke; and many n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by her father Norman; mother Colleen; father-in-law Curtis Fleming; brother-in-law Jim Stetzel and granddaughter Reese Bryan.
